摘要
In this paper, antenna subset selection for downlink millimeter wave (mmWave) massive MIMO systems is studied. A low complexity method is proposed to select antenna subset on a uniform planar array (UPA) in base station. The antenna subset selection is reduced to find the optimal positions of the sub-arrays on the UPA. Numerical results show that our proposed antenna subset selections with two or four sub-arrays are superior to transmission using all antennas when the number of users is two in high SNR regime.
